I blis (Satan) was in fact a jinn who used to worship Allah along with the angels. When Allah Almighty commanded the angels to prostrate, he did not prostrate. He came down on arrogance, hatred and bigotry and rejected Allah’s command with contempt (Al-Baqarah: 34). It’s from this story of the Prophet that we get to know about the condemnation of iblis. During the mid-16th century, several gorgeously illuminated versions of the Qiṣaṣ - such as Zubdat al-Tawarikh and Siyer-i Nebi - were created by Ottoman authors and miniature painters. According to Milstein et al., "iconographical study [of the texts] reveals ideological programs and cliché typical of the Ottoman polemical discourse with its Shi‘ite rival in Iran, and its Christian neighbors in the West."
